- England, Hayden (Haydon) L.
Army, World War I, Born Weed, Ky., December 1896. His family lived in Adair Co. in 1900 and 1910 and the Cave Ridge community in Metcalfe County by mid-1918. He was billeted at the U.S. Army Recruiting Station, Kansas City, Missouri in January 1920; by February 1921, he had attained the grade of Corporal and was serving in the First Military Police Company, stationed at Fort Dix, New Jersey.
